The foundation of Ayurveda lies in the concept of doshas—three fundamental energies that influence our physical and mental characteristics: Vata, Pitta, and Kapha. Each individual has a unique combination of these doshas, which shapes their tendencies, health, and reactions to the environment.
Tip: Identifying your dosha can help tailor lifestyle choices—like diet and meditation practices—to better suit your needs and promote balance.

In Ayurveda, foods are categorized into three gunas: Sattva (pure), Rajas (active), and Tamas (inertia). Sattvic foods promote clarity, energy, and health, making them ideal for those seeking balance.
Tip: Transitioning to a Sattvic diet can involve incorporating more whole, fresh foods while reducing intake of processed items.
